MER型沸石的结构、合成及应用进展  被引量:3

Advances in structure,synthesis and application of MER zeolite

摘  要:MER型沸石是一种稀有的三维八元环小孔沸石,因其特殊的孔道结构和良好的物化性质,在海水卤水提钾、工业催化、气体吸附分离以及工业脱水等领域展现出了潜在的应用前景。对MER型沸石的结构、合成和应用的研究现状进行了较为全面的综述,并对其研究方向进行了展望,为进一步研究MER型沸石并对其进行推广应用提供了参考。MER zeolite is a kind of rare small-porosity zeolite with a low silicon-aluminum ratio,which has a typical eight-membered ring main channel structure with three-dimensional interconnection.Due to special pore structure and good physical and chemical properties,MER zeolite is widely used in different industrial fields.It can be used as adsorbents for potassium extraction in salt water,or as a catalyst for FCC gasoline hydro-upgrading and catalytic dehydration of methanol to dimethyl ether,or as a solid basic catalyst.It can also be used as zeolite membranes for CO2/CH4 separations and dehydration of organic solvents.The structure,synthesis,and application of MER zeolite were reviewed and prospected,which will provide a reference for the further study of MER zeolite and its applications.

关 键 词:MER型沸石 沸石W 提钾 分离 催化 脱水
